Higher mAh = More Top Speed
 
On Traxxas website they say that with the VXL if you use a 4000mAh you hit 65+mph but if you use 8000mah you hit 70+. Wouldn't they be the same just the 8000mah have more run time

it delivers more constant amps and therefore when you pull more amps you get less voltage drop. voltage X kv = speed

Think of it in terms of power. Power = voltage x current. The faster you go, the more power is required. As tashpop said, a pack with a higher capacity and with the same "C" rating will be able to deliver more current at the same voltage drop as a lower capacity pack, which gives more power.
